Scalability AWS Lambda automatically scales your Selenium tests by running multiple instances simultaneously, allowing for efficient parallel testing without managing servers.
Cost-effectiveness With AWS Lambda, you only pay for the compute time that you consume, which can significantly reduce costs compared to traditional server-based deployments, especially for occasional testing.
Maintenance-free AWS Lambda abstracts away server maintenance, updates, and patch management, allowing you to focus exclusively on writing and executing Selenium tests.
Integration with AWS Services AWS Lambda integrates seamlessly with other AWS services such as S3, DynamoDB, and API Gateway, enabling you to build comprehensive, cloud-native testing workflows.
Possible disadvantages of Selenium in AWS Lambda
Execution Time Limitations AWS Lambda imposes a maximum execution time limit (15 minutes as of 2023), which may not be sufficient for running extensive Selenium test suites.
Cold Start Latency When Lambda functions are not frequently invoked, they can experience latency during cold starts, potentially affecting the performance of Selenium tests.
Browser Environment Setup Running Selenium in AWS Lambda requires setting up browser binaries in a serverless environment, which can be complex and may require custom Lambda layers or container images.
Resource Limitations Lambda functions have restricted memory and computing capabilities, which might limit the execution of resource-intensive Selenium tests.
